#eb0403 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b0403 is composed of 92.2% red, 1.6%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.3%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 0.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 46.7%. #eb0403 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0806 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

Shades and Tints of #eb0403
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030000 is the darkest color, while #ffeeee is the lightest one.

Tones of #eb0403
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7171 is the less saturated color, while #eb0403 is the most saturated one.
